- The distance between Zamboanga City, Philippines and Prizzi, Italy is approximately 11,143 km or 6,924 mi.
- To reach Zamboanga City in this distance one would set out from Prizzi bearing 72.9°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Zamboanga City bearing 130.4° or SE .
- Zamboanga City has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Prizzi has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- The average annual temperature is 15.3 °C (27.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.4 °C (29.5°F) less in Zamboanga City.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 522.3 mm (20.6 in) more which is equivalent to 522.3 l/m² (12.82 US gal/ft²) or 5,223,000 l/ha (558,373 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.9° higher in Zamboanga City than in Prizzi.
- Relative humidity levels are 12.4%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 17.5°C (31.6°F) higher.
